Abstract
Inefficient warehousing processes can lead to various types of waste, such as long waiting times, long product transfer distances, and repetitive processes. These conditions can increase lead times and decrease warehouse operational efficiency. This problem also occurs in the finished goods warehouse of PT XYZ Sidoarjo Unit, which still shows waste in the warehouse flow process. The purpose of this research is to reduce waste in the warehouse flow process and provide improvement suggestions. The method used in this research is the Lean Warehouse approach with Value Stream Mapping (VSM), Value Stream Analysis Tools (VALSAT), fishbone diagram, and 5W+1H to reduce waste in the warehouse flow process. The results of the study show that the lead time in the current state is 447 minutes, while the lead time in the future state is 269 minutes. Meanwhile, the Process Cycle Efficiency (PCE) value in the current state is 20,81%, and after improvements were made using the Lean Warehouse approach, the Process Cycle Efficiency (PCE) became 34,57%. This resulted in a 13,76% increase in process efficiency. Thus, the lean warehouse approach can reduce waste and improve the efficiency of the warehouse flow process.
